India, May 9 -- At just 23, Michael Cooper Jr. is already carving a name for himself in Hollywood. With soulful eyes, a quiet charisma, and a performance in Netflix's Forever that has critics and audiences talking, Cooper represents a new generation of talent: self-aware, emotionally tuned, and rooted in something deeper than fame, as reported by Page Six.

Born to Kemba and Michael Cooper Sr.-a nurse and a pharmacist, respectively-Michael grew up in a family that emphasised discipline, education, and faith. Though his parents weren't involved in the arts, their structure gave Michael the focus he needed to pursue something wildly different: acting, as reported by The Hollywood Reporter.
